FERREIRA, Shana Pires; RUIZ, Walter Augusto and GASPAR-CUNHA, António. Influence of extrusion temperature on rheological properties of wheat gluten bioplastic. Rev. de Ciências Agrárias [online]. 2014, vol.37, n.1, pp.10-19. ISSN 0871-018X.
The main objective of this work was to study the influence of different extrusion conditions on thermal and rheological properties of biopolymers of wheat gluten plasticized with glycerol. The temperature of the heating zones of the extruder co-rotating twin screw influences the rheological and thermal properties of biopolymers. Temperatures between 55 oC and 60 oC produced extrudates with good looks and low roughness. The extrudates showed high values of G’ and G’’ and shaping the extrusion process showed that the change in configuration of the heating zones mainly influences the location of the deformation along the extruder.
